TL;DR: A 50-guest wedding in Richmond, CA typically costs $22,000 β $40,000, with most couples landing around $30,000 ($600/guest). The biggest swing factors are venue type (waterfront vs. backyard), whether you hire a full caterer, and your photography tier.

Richmond sits on the East Bay shoreline with views of the Bay Bridge, San Francisco, and Mt. Tamalpais β which means you can get genuinely beautiful waterfront weddings at 20β30% less than San Francisco or Napa equivalents. For 50 guests, that intimacy lets you upgrade where it matters (food, photography, a real florist) without the per-head pressure of a 150-person event.
Plan for these realities:
- Venue + catering will eat 50β60% of your budget. This is where Richmond's location both helps (lower rental rates than SF) and hurts (Bay Area catering minimums still apply).
- A 50-guest count is a sweet spot β most caterers, photographers, and florists offer micro-wedding packages here, and you can often book in 6β9 months instead of 12+.
- Don't skip the wedding insurance ($150β$300). Bay Area weather is mild but venues require liability coverage.

Realistic Richmond, CA budget ranges for 50 guests:
| Category | Lean ($22K) | Typical ($30K) | Elevated ($40K)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Venue (rental + fees) | $3,500 | $6,000 | $9,500 |
| Catering (food + service) | $6,000 | $8,500 | $12,000 |
| Bar (beer/wine, 4 hrs) | $1,200 | $2,000 | $3,500 |
| Photography | $2,500 | $3,800 | $6,000 |
| Videography | $0 | $1,800 | $3,500 |
| Flowers + decor | $1,500 | $2,800 | $4,500 |
| Music (DJ or duo) | $1,200 | $2,000 | $3,200 |
| Attire (both partners) | $1,800 | $2,800 | $4,500 |
| Stationery + signage | $400 | $700 | $1,200 |
| Cake / dessert | $300 | $500 | $900 |
| Officiant | $400 | $600 | $900 |
| Hair + makeup | $500 | $900 | $1,500 |
| Coordinator (month-of) | $1,200 | $1,800 | $3,000 |
| Rentals (linens, chairs) | $800 | $1,400 | $2,500 |
| Transportation | $0 | $600 | $1,500 |
| Buffer (5β10%) | $700 | $1,800 | $3,800 |
Per-guest math: $440 (lean) / $600 (typical) / $800 (elevated).

Where people get married in Richmond:
- Craneway Pavilion / Rosie the Riveter waterfront β historic industrial venues with Bay views; rental fees run $4,000β$8,000 for a half-day with a 50-person setup.
- Point Richmond restaurants and bistros β full buyouts of places like Hotel Mac or Salute e Vita can run $5,000β$10,000 all-in including food.
- Miller/Knox Regional Shoreline β permits are cheap ($150β$400) but you bring everything.
- Backyard or Airbnb estate weddings in El Cerrito or Kensington hills β popular for 50-guest counts; budget $2,000β$5,000 for tent/restroom rentals.
Cost drivers specific to the East Bay:
- Catering minimums. Most Bay Area caterers won't book under $5,000β$7,500 in food costs alone. At 50 guests, you'll likely hit minimums comfortably but won't get bulk discounts.
- Service charges and SF County tax differentials. Richmond's sales tax is 9.75%; budget caterers often add a 20β22% service charge on top.
- Parking and transit. Many Richmond venues are car-dependent β factor in shuttles from BART (Richmond station) if guests are coming from SF or Oakland.
- Wind and fog. Waterfront ceremonies need weighted dΓ©cor and a Plan B tent option from May through August.
Booking timeline at 50 guests: You can realistically pull off a Richmond wedding in 5β7 months if you stay flexible on date (Friday or Sunday opens up vendor calendars and shaves 10β15% off rates).

Is $30,000 enough for a 50-guest wedding in Richmond, CA?
Yes β $30,000 is the typical landing spot for 50 guests in Richmond and gives you a real venue, full catering, professional photography, flowers, and a DJ. You'll need to make trade-offs (skip videography, or choose beer/wine over full bar), but it's a comfortable mid-tier budget locally.
What's the cheapest realistic budget for 50 guests in Richmond?
About $18,000β$22,000 if you use a regional park or backyard, hire a taco or BBQ caterer ($45β$65/person), self-manage bar, and book a newer photographer. Below $18K, you're moving into pure DIY territory or cutting the guest count.
How much should I budget per guest in Richmond, CA?
Plan for $500β$700 per guest for a typical Richmond wedding, including everything (not just food). At 50 guests, that puts you in the $25Kβ$35K range. Per-guest costs drop slightly at higher counts because fixed costs like photography and venue rental spread further.
Are Richmond weddings cheaper than San Francisco weddings?
Yes β typically 20β30% cheaper for comparable quality. Venue rental fees and overhead are lower in the East Bay, but catering, flowers, and photography pull from the same Bay Area vendor pool, so those line items don't drop as much.
How far in advance should I book a Richmond venue for 50 guests?
6β9 months is comfortable for most Richmond venues at this size, vs. 12β18 months for larger weddings. Waterfront venues like Craneway book further out (10β14 months for peak Saturdays in MayβOctober).
Do I need a wedding planner for a 50-guest wedding?
A month-of coordinator ($1,500β$2,500) is worth it for nearly every couple β they handle vendor timing, day-of logistics, and family questions. A full-service planner ($5,000+) is usually overkill at 50 guests unless you're doing something complex like a multi-day event.
What's the biggest hidden cost couples miss in Richmond?
Service charges, taxes, and rentals. A $100/person catering quote often becomes $130/person after 22% service charge and 9.75% tax. And many venues quote rental separately from chairs, linens, glassware, and flatware β which can add $1,000β$2,500.
